To: Executive Team
From: Darel Quist
Subject: Logistics provider change

Effective next quarter we move all outbound freight from Hallorn Transit to Vexmore Cargo. Drivers: 11% cost reduction, better cold-chain coverage in the Ostrev corridor, and contractual penalties for late delivery. Transition runs eight weeks; Priya Namdar leads the cutover. Expect minor disruption in weeks three and four. Customer comms go out Friday. For the incoming director, the broader plan behind this switch is set out immediately below.

board note of bahaf-kahif: Gross margin on Wenael came in at 10 percent against a plan of 15 percent. Only 7 of the 120 pilot accounts renewed Wenael, so a churn review is set for July 1.

## Digest Scheduling — Quickstart

Batch email digests on Mailloom run from the scheduler pod every hour at :15. Each tenant has a preferred send window; the scheduler skips tenants outside theirs and retries next cycle. Never trigger a manual run during the top-of-hour ingest, or you'll double-send. To force a run, use the admin console's replay action. Confirm you're on the build shown below first.

trace token, fafog-kageg: htk4_98e6

Subject: Loyalty programme overhaul — heads up

Hi all,

As trailed at the offsite, we're rebuilding the Kestrel Rewards scheme from the ground up. The points model is being replaced with tiered perks, and the clunky redemption portal goes in the bin. Tomas's team has a working prototype; pilot starts with the Ashgrove region in six weeks. Expect some noise from long-standing members — comms pack is coming. Budget and staffing asks land next week. One strategic detail stays in this group.

board note of bajop-yaweg: The western region missed its Pelys quota by 58.0 percent last quarter. Pelysek Foods plans to raise the Belius list price by 44.0 percent in July. The steering committee signed off on a budget of $133.8 million for Project Pelax. The renewal with Zoraelix Systems closes at $61.9 million a year, 12.7 percent above the last contract.